Stoltenberg: Russia’s Attempts To Intimidate Us Lead To Opposite Result

NATO Secretary General Jens Stoltenberg said: “Russia’s attempts to intimidate us the opposite result,

NATO members strengthen the support of Ukraine. “

President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elensky and Stoltenberg held a press conference as part of the NATO summit.

NATO Secretary General Stoltenberg said that Ukraine will support NATO membership, which has entered the “irreversible” path.

Having emphasized that Ukraine has the right to self -defense in accordance with international law, Stoltenberg said: “NATO allies also have the right to support Ukraine’s right to self -defense without getting involved in conflict.”

Stoltenberg noted that in the framework of the right to self-defense, Ukraine has the right to strike on the military targets of the “aggressor-Russia”.

According to Stoltenberg, EU member countries weakened restrictions on the use of weapons sent to Ukraine, which opened up the path to striking on military facilities in Russia.

Stoltenberg noted that Russia is trying to intimidate NATO members with various initiatives because of their support for Ukraine: “Russia’s efforts to intimidate us are counterproductive. On the contrary, NATO members strengthen their support.”

Russia occupies our land and wants to take our lives

The President of Ukraine Zelensky, in turn, called on countries that supply weapons for victory, to remove “all restrictions”.

“Russia will occupy our land, Russia wants to take our lives,” Zelensky said, adding that Moscow, in fact, wants to show other countries what it is capable of.

“We must maintain unity with all our partners. We should not allow Russia to normalize aggressive wars.”

Having stated that Ukraine has achieved specific successes within the framework of the NATO summit, Zelensky noted that these decisions are of great importance for the Ukrainian people and their children.

Zelensky added that today, together with the Member States, the Ukrainian Charter will be signed. According to him, this is important for the Architecture of Ukraine.

The president noted that Ukraine is getting closer to membership in NATO and will take all the necessary steps to become its member.

A meeting of the NATO-Ukraine Council at the Leaders’ level

as part of the NATO summit, a meeting of the NATO-Ukraine Council was held at the Leaders’ level with the participation of the President of Zelensky.

Speaking with a brief speech at the beginning of the meeting, the Secretary General of NATO Stoltenberg said: “We are building a foundation for the victory of Ukraine.”

The Secretary General recalled that they made a very comprehensive assistance package for Ukraine, and today additional decisions will be made.

He said that these decisions will clearly demonstrate NATO support and at the same time confirm that the future of Ukraine is in NATO.
